Hagerstown Police Department, Indiana
End of Watch Wednesday, January 29, 1997
Add to My HeroesJimmy Martin Miller
Patrolman Jimmy Miller suffered a fatal heart attack during an endurance test at the Indiana Law Enforcement Academy at 5402 Sugar Grove Road in Plainfield.
Classmates rendered aid, and he was transported to Hendricks County Hospital, where he was unable to be revived.
Patrolman Miller had served as a reserve officer with the Hagerstown Police Department for 21 years and had decided to become a full-time officer. He was survived by his wife, daughter, son, who was a reserve officer, and four grandchildren.
